It probably strange to think of a time when the security of the President of the United States wasn't a top priority. That time would be right around five days after the Civil War ended with the surrender of Robert E Lee and his confederate forces. It should have been a time of rebuilding and healing as a nation, but a man named John Wilkes Booth (you may have heard of him) took it upon himself (maybe?) to avenge the defeat of the south by killing the man who lead the Union to victory.
